Output e940d147fccc63ed20a395a0d790ba9081254fa232db6cc8f7bdebb7b91e8b85:23

value
51084
script pubkey
OP_0 OP_PUSHBYTES_20 baaa223ec1fccf9d7683d2476f42523aa52d8417
address
bc1qh24zy0kpln8e6a5r6frk7sjj82jjmpqhhfz3ew
transaction
e940d147fccc63ed20a395a0d790ba9081254fa232db6cc8f7bdebb7b91e8b85
confirmations
17329
spent
true